4. Holding both sides of the top cover, close the top cover.
ATTENTION
Be careful that the top cover does not shut on your fingers.
Confirm that the top cover is completely closed. If not completely closed, document
jams and feeding errors may occur.
When closing the top cover, do not slam it shut by pushing the LCD touch panel as this
may damage it.
You should hear a click.

If document jams or multifeed errors occur frequently, try the following procedures.
1. Align the edges of the document sheets.
2. Fan the documents.
1. Lightly grip the ends of the document stack in both hands, and fan two or three
times.
2. Rotate the documents 90 degrees, and fan again.
